Technovation Girls is a global technology program that empowers young women in grades 6 through 12 to solve real-world problems in their communities using coding and artificial intelligence. Students work in teams alongside mentors and volunteers to design and build technology solutions that address genuine community needs, developing skills in programming, leadership, and problem-solving along the way. Teams can participate through local Chapters and Clubs or independently, making the program accessible to students around the world.
